We introduce Platform for Situated Intelligence, an open-source framework created to support the rapid development and study of multimodal, integrative-AI systems. The framework provides infrastructure for sensing, fusing, and making inferences from temporal streams of data across different modalities, a set of tools that enable visualization and debugging, and an ecosystem of components that encapsulate a variety of perception and processing technologies. These assets jointly provide the means for rapidly constructing and refining multimodal, integrative-AI systems, while retaining the efficiency and performance characteristics required for deployment in open-world settings.

An Interaction Design Toolkit for Physical Task Guidance with Artificial Intelligence and Mixed Reality
A design toolkit for AI-plus-mixed-reality physical task guidance: six design considerations, 36 design patterns, and an interaction canvas, derived from student prototypes and tested in a small user study.

Evaluating Joint Attention for Mixed-Presence Collaboration on Wall-Sized Displays
A head-tracking based method quantifies joint attention for four people across two rooms on wall-sized displays, with preliminary evidence that gaze correlates among collaborators.
